Raspberry White Chocolate Bars
Taste of Home June/July 2001
Reviews rate this recipe 4.5 of 5 stars.
Prep: 20 min. Bake: 45 min.
Yield: 2 dozen.
A co-worker's mother gave me this gem of a recipe a few years back. I can never decide what's more appealing�the attractive look of the bars or their incredible aroma while they're baking! Everyone who tries these asks for the recipe. �Mimi Priesman Pace, Florida
Ingredients:
� 1/2 cup butter, cubed
� 1 package (10 to 12 ounces) white baking chips, divided
� 2 eggs
� 1/2 cup sugar
� 1 teaspoon almond extract
� 1 cup all-purpose flour
� 1/2 teaspoon salt
� 1/2 cup seedless raspberry jam
� 1/4 cup sliced almonds
Directions:
1. In a small saucepan, melt butter. Remove from the heat; add 1 cup chips (do not stir). In a small bowl, beat eggs until foamy; gradually add sugar. Stir in chip mixture and almond extract. Combine flour and salt; gradually add to egg mixture just until combined.
2. Spread half of the batter into a greased 9-in. square baking pan. Bake at 325� for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
3. In a small saucepan, melt jam over low heat; spread over warm crust. Stir remaining chips into the remaining batter; drop by teaspoonfuls over the jam layer. Sprinkle with almonds.
4. Bake 30-35 minutes longer or until a toothpick inserted near the center comes out clean. Cool on a wire rack. Cut into bars.
1 serving (1 each) equals 162 calories, 9 g fat (5 g saturated fat), 30 mg cholesterol, 104 mg sodium, 20 g carbohydrate, trace fiber, 2 g protein.
